Forget about the Breachways on a weekend, they can still be good but the stinkin' crowds... Quonnie is my favorite for ease of fishing but C-Town produces bigger fish (for me anyway)... Otherwise, it all depends on how you want to fish... Plenty of shoreline that is mostly good at various times with a couple places that stand out if yiou are prepared AND are willing to work at it....
I don't advise anyone fishing the breachways and rockpiles of Rhody unless they are wearing Korkers or similarly studded soles... Felt is OK for a while then steel needs to take over...
